  • Long term Planning - capacity issue

    Does any one have a way of running Long Term Planning in SAP.
    When checking CM38 for production volumes, the start dates of
    the planned orders always fall into the previous month from the
    forecast (the monthly forecast is always placed on the first day
    of the period and due to lead time scheduling the planned orders
    to satisfy that forecast fall into the previous month). If i check the
    capacity it show in same month for different month requirment.( it is clubing the requirment)
    Though capacity scene was created from June to August , system shows loading from May month.
    Month wise loading and availability are shown clubbed in capacity planning sheet.
    Thanks in advanc....

    Mukesh,
    To change the forecast from occuring at start of period ( month) you can always select the Schedule line Tab in MD61,MD62. then select period indicator as Day format as shown below
    Per. Ind          Date              Qty
    D     17.05.2010     30
    D     15.06.2010     40
    D     15.07.2010     50
    System will then plan PIR (forcast) based on dates assigned by user instead of being placed on the first day
    of the period. This will prevent forcast to fall into the previous month. Also it will resolve the capacity issue you are facing.

  • Re: Long term Planning

    Dear All,
    I am trying to do Long term Planning. In my case I am not using SOP. Demand is entered into SAP through PIR (i.e. PIR).
    I want to see how much load is there on all the resources available.
    Please advice me how to proceed in this direction.
    Regards,
    Vivek Sharma

    Dear Vivek,
    Check with these steps,
    1.A plannig scenario has to be created for a plant in T code MS31 & for the same Planning scenario
    configuration settings has to be made in OPU5 for the planned orders for LTP.
    2.Requirements has to be given in MD61 in an inactive version and also after giving the requirements
    kindly remove the tick mark against version- active check box.
    3.Assign this plan to the planning scenario in MS32,release it and ensure the planning file entries are
    entered or created,the same can be checked using MS21.
    4.After taking LTP simulation run in MS02(individual material) or MS01 you can see the simulated
    planned orders obtained in MS04 T code.
    5.These Simulated planned orders can't be converted into production orders or it cant be used for any
    business confirmation purpose.
    6. For capacity planning analysis,use T Code CM38,
    Before that Ensure for all the work centers in CR03 which are used for operation under capacity header
    you have included the check box for Long term planning,otherwise in CM38 you can't see any capacity
    requirements data.
    7.Before executing CM38,ensure under settings---> general you are giving the period settings properly.
    Revert back incase of any more clarifications required.

  • Long term Planning in SAP

    Hi Gurus,
    I am new to SAP,this my 1st query in SDN.
    I have been given sales figures of last 5 years of particular organization and i have been told to create a long term planning report in SAP please tell me the detailed methodology of create a long plan for the next 6 months in SAP.
    Regards
    Krish

    Dear Krish,
    LTP is a planning tool,where simulated planned orders's are obtained for an inactive plan.
    It will be more helpful from production perspective.
    To carry out an annual planning or a rolling quarterly planning run you require information on the future stock and requirements
    situation. This means you need to know how sales and operations planning influence resources. That is, whether the results
    of sales planning can actually be produced with capacity on hand. If such information is available it is possible to decide at an
    early date whether extra work centers will be required to cope with bottlenecks, or whether additional machinery will have to
    be purchased to reach the sales target.
    Steps for LTP:
    1.A plannig scenario has to be created for a plant in T code MS31 & for the same Planning scenario
    configuration settings has to be made in OPU5 for the planned orders for LTP.
    2.Requirements has to be given in MD61 in an inactive version and also after giving the requirements
    kindly remove the tick mark against version- active check box.
    3.Assign this plan to the planning scenario in MS32,release it and ensure the planning file entries are
    entered or created,the same can be checked using MS21.
    4.After taking LTP simulation run in MS02(individual material) or MS01 you can see the simulated
    planned orders obtained in MS04 T code.
    5.These Simulated planned orders can't be converted into production orders or it cant be used for any
    business confirmation purpose.
    6. For capacity planning analysis,use T Code CM38,
    Before that Ensure for all the work centers in CR03 which are used for operation under capacity header
    you have included the check box for Long term planning,otherwise in CM38 you can't see any capacity requirements data.
    7.Before executing CM38,ensure under settings---> general you are giving the period settings properly.
    8.Use T Code KSPP to transfer the planned activity requirements for production.
    Revert back incase of any more clarifications required.
